The most effective Firewood for the Wooden Stove or Fireplace
All Wooden burns, but not all woods burn a similar. Some burn up hotter, slower, and cleaner than Other individuals. Some smoke a whole lot, and some have loads of sap or resin that clogs your chimney swiftly. The very best sorts of firewood for any Wooden stove or fireplace melt away scorching and comparatively steadily, developing a lot more heat and, ordinarily, burning much more totally. These woods are typically hardwoods, which include hickory or ash, as opposed to softwoods, for example pine and cedar.Hardwood Firewood
Hardwoods which include maple, oak, ash, birch, and many fruit trees are the very best burning woods that provides you with a hotter and extended melt away time. These woods hold the minimum pitch and sap and so are normally cleaner to manage. However, hardwoods are normally more expensive than softwoods and are more prone to leave clinkers, a hard and stony residue, from the leftover ash.
When you are burning birch firewood, be familiar with the thick internal brown bark known as the phloem. This bark retains a lot of moisture and will prevent the wood from drying evenly.1 Thus, it is best To combine birch with Yet another variety of hardwood for a cleaner burn off and less smoke. Smoke leads to a buildup of creosote, which is a byproduct of Wooden combustion consisting largely of tar that usually leads to chimney fires.2
Softwood Firewood
Softwood is The most affordable style of wood You should purchase. Fir is your best option, but other softwoods incorporate pine, balsam, spruce, cedar, tamarack, alder, and poplar. Softwoods often burn a lot quicker and depart finer ash in comparison to hardwoods.three Additionally they is usually messy to take care of, In particular pine, spruce, and balsam, since they bring about creosote to make up additional promptly as part of your chimney.
Comparing Firewood by Warmth Power
Unique firewoods can be categorized by the level of heat Electricity they create per twine of Wooden. The most beneficial firewoods present the heat-Electrical power equivalent of 200 to 250 gallons of gas oil.four These involve the subsequent:
Apple
Beech (American)
Birch (Yellow)
Hickory (Shagbark)
Ironwood
Maple (Sugar)
Purple oak
White ash
White oak
The next classification of heat energy would be the equal of one hundred fifty to two hundred gallons of gas for each cord of firewood. These woods include:
Birch (White)
Cherry (Black)
Douglas fir
Elm (American)
Maple (Red and Silver)
Tamarack
In the lowest warmth-Strength group, Each and every wire of Wooden creates with regard to the similar heat as one hundred to one hundred fifty gallons of gas oil:
Alder (Red)
Aspen
Cedar (Crimson)
Cottonwood
Hemlock
Pine (Lodgepole and White)
Redwood
Spruce (Sitka)
Ensure that Your Wood Is Dry
You must never burn up "eco-friendly," or insufficiently dried, wood since it produces significantly less heat plus much more smoke (and, in the long run, creosote) than properly dried, or seasoned, wood. For good storage, you ought to stack your Wooden for effective air circulation, covered at the highest only, and ensure it is carefully dry in advance of burning. A superb guideline is to rotate your firewood, as in burning the more mature dryer wood initial, to stop wood rot and waste.
Wooden should have a dampness content of a lot less that 20 percent for burning. Together with the dampness higher than 20 p.c, wood is hard to start and burns improperly and inefficiently, making extreme amounts of h2o vapor, smoke, and harmful air.5
Woods to stop
Salvaged firewood or other scraps can help you save lots of money In terms of heating your home with wood. But you will discover specified wood solutions and other items that you need to stay clear of for health and safety good reasons. Many of such will create dangerous fumes indoors, along with chimney emissions that might be an environmental problem.six Some also pose added threats on your stove metals or can create a hazardous buildup of creosote inside your chimney.
For your safety you should normally prevent burning:
Painted or varnished wood, trim, or other wood by-products
Pressure-addressed lumber
Driftwood
Engineered sheet goods, for example plywood, particleboard, and MDF
Hardboard or other compressed paper products6
In case you experience allergy symptoms, some woods, Specifically aromatic cedar, must also be utilized with warning.
